I've used some hand guards & I think they were Bark busters Blizzard They are made of what appears to be heavy nylon & so are more flexible than the plastic ones. I find they work very well as they really reduce the wind chill factor, as that is the killer on a bike. I tried heated grips prior to this but was unimpressed as once you get a move on they don't seem to work, & the back of your hand takes all the wind anyhow. Now I fit the hand guards for winter & bring out the Gerbing gloves when it is is very cold, as Geoff says they work well. The guards are the cheapest most effective thing i've found so far.
